Right just wondering what people think of this. A local North East firm pay there part 1's £8ph, part £2's 9ph and adv £10. Ano them rates are shocking, but majority of the work is price and they've came up with this bonus scheme. Right just say for instance if your squad is made up of a part 1, 2 and an advanced scaffolder your flat weekly wage would be £1053 but for your bonus to kick in you have to make an extra 22% on that which gives you £1284.66 then any thing you make after that, is classed as your bonus which you also get a 13% squad charge deduction off. So just say you get a price job and the company says it's £2000
Job £2000
squad weekly wage £1053
Squad wage plus 22% £1284.66.
Bonus = £715.34
bonus minus 13% squad charge £622.35
Then you divide that by your squad
advanced 40%=£248.94
Part2 35% =£217.82
Part1 25% =£155.59
Then you get that bonus in 2 weeks on top of your flat wage.
